English Teacher

Teaching Personnel are seeking a passionate and dedicated English Teacher to join our vibrant and forward-thinking secondary school in Caerphilly. This is an exciting opportunity to become part of a thriving educational community, where students are encouraged to reach their full potential academically, creatively, and personally.

  • Position: English Teacher
  • Location: Caerphilly, South Wales
  • Pay: £157.66 - £217.77 per day (paid scale
  • Start date: asap
  • Contract: Full-time (Term time only)

About the Role:

As an English Teacher, you will:

  • Teach across Key Stages 3 and 4, with the possibility of Key Stage 5 for the right candidate.
  • Plan, prepare, and deliver engaging and inspiring lessons that promote a love of literature and language.
  • Support students in developing critical thinking, reading, writing, and communication skills.
  • Monitor and assess student progress, providing feedback and support to help everyone achieve their goals.
  • Contribute to the wider school community, including involvement in extracurricular activities and literacy initiatives.

About You:

We are looking for a teacher who:

  • Is passionate about the English language and literature and can inspire that enthusiasm in students.
  • Has a strong understanding of the national curriculum and the ability to deliver high-quality lessons.
  • Holds Qualified Teacher Status (QTS) or is a New Qualified Teacher (NQT) with relevant English Degree
  • Is a positive and collaborative team member with excellent communication skills.
  • Is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people.

About the school?

  • Approximately, 1200 students ages from 11-18
  • Strong focus on academic success and personal development
  • Committed to inclusion, ensuring that all students, including those with ALN, are fully supported
  • A committed and experienced teaching staff dedicated to providing high-quality education and personalised support for students.
